"The Voyage of Vanishing Men" by Stanley Mullen is a science fiction story from the mid-20th century that follows Braun after his ship mysteriously returns from a space mission, forever changed from being one of the few survivors of "Venture IV." The story deals with feeling alone, worrying about existence, and the dangers of going into unexplored space. As Braun tries to explain what happened to his lost crew, he is met with doubt, haunted by the journey and marked by encountering the emptiness of space. The novel creates a feeling of tension and thinking deeply, as Braun considers the desire to explore and what it costs to go where no one has gone before, making readers think about the results of humans always wanting to know more.

About the AuthorStanley Mullen was an American artist, short story writer, novelist and publisher. He studied writing at the University of Colorado at Boulder and drawing, painting and lithography at the Colorado Springs Fine Arts Center where he was accepted as a professional member in 1937. A series of his paintings of Indian ceremonial dances is part of the permanent collection of the Denver Art Museum. Mullen worked as assistant curator of the Colorado State Historical Museum during the 1940s.
